We Pirates are making learning a grand adventure. We find inspirational volunteers who give kids intensive 1-1 attention, because teachers can't do it all. And we don't just do school work - because school is not much like real life! Our young Pirates work on making real-world products like websites & books, which develop their real-world skills (as well as their literacy grades). We work in a wacky creative space that's different to school. And then we rent our space and sell our products so we can live sustainably from the creative work we do

The Hackney Pirates are transforming the WHO, WHERE and WHAT of learning. WHO should be helping young people learn? You should! With the right training, all the community have a really important role to play in sharing skills & knowledge. WHERE should people learn? Well companies like Google think it's worth making amazing spaces for a productive working environment, and we believe that kids derserve the same. So we've created an incredible creative learning centre complete with secret passageways and wonky libraries, that others can rent. And WHAT? Young people need to work on projects that matter, so we get them working alongside creative professionals to make real, saleable stuff they care about, which develops their literacy as they go.
